Casey House operates Canada's longest-running artist-run centre, providing affordable studio and exhibition space for visual artists in Toronto. The organization supports emerging and established artists through subsidized studio rentals, public programming, and community engagement initiatives. By maintaining accessible creative spaces in an increasingly expensive city, Casey House removes barriers that prevent artists from developing their practice and sharing work with the public. The centre hosts regular exhibitions, artist talks, and cultural events that connect the local art community and audiences. Casey House demonstrates that artist-centred infrastructure remains essential for sustaining vibrant cultural production in the GTA.
